European Stocks Pause Near War-Era Highs as Fresh U.S. Strikes on Iran Jolt Markets - Tekedia

  1. European stocks slipped after renewed U.S. strikes in southern Iran revived conflict fears.

  2. Brent crude and WTI jumped on worries about Middle East supply disruptions, including the Strait of Hormuz.

  3. The move dampened hopes for a de-escalation deal and increased market volatility.

  4. Investors also reassessed the outlook for a June ECB rate hike as higher energy costs could lift inflation.
